so i changed my oil in the getrag, getting hot out so i wanted some synthetic not knowing what was in there, took out the shifter, filled her up, replaced the shifter, now i cant get it to shift. what did i miss? kept the retainer screws in the same spot, any help would be appreciated, got to go to work in the morning
Sometimes taking things apart then putting them back together fixes the problem. Then before you put the long lever back on, you should be able to move the stub lever back and forth to be sure it's engaged in the rails or shifter mechanism.
Was the shifter in NEUTRAL before removing it ??
Remove the shifter, look inside and see if the slots are all lined up for NEUTRAL; if not, line them up with a big screw-driver or the like, then re-install the shifter, making sure the end goes in the slots.
Never pull a shifter with the transmission in gear, always in NEUTRAL.

yah , i got it. thank you gentlemen for the reply's. I looked in the sticky for the proper fork allignement, 1/2 was a little off. big screwdriver popped it right in. like a edit, i started to take the snapring off in 1st gear.
